Thanks for the pointer to the build. The builder did a fairly creditable job using styrene and it's ok....... I hope mine is better as would be expected with the advantage of 3d printing.

Here's the start
Image
Image

These are just the prototype prints, the real wheels will have 5x14x5 bearings front and back. They are ordered and will arrive next week. I'm probably over-engineering this but I don't know what the finished weight will be and I definitely don't want suspension issues when driving. The real thing could do 40mph over rough ground and there are lots of pictures of them leaving the ground :crazy:

Well, I'm bemused, amazed, and a little awed.

Image

Anyone giving this a casual glance could be forgiven for thinking I had given up on rc tanks and vehicles and decided to build boats instead 8O :crazy: :haha:

It isn't a model aircraft carrier or landing craft, it is in fact the lower hull of the 1/6 scale Universal or Bren Carrier. IT'S HUGE!

Anyway it's the prototype for one. I'm not 100% sold on using ply and may revert to styrene. This is 3mm ply, and I think 4mm of good old styrene sheet would probably provide a stiffer and stronger solution but this works as a prototype.

Now I'm glad I over-engineered that suspension.
